The Transportation Research Board (TRB) Annual Meeting is a premier event that draws thousands of transportation professionals from around the globe. This prestigious gathering features a comprehensive program encompassing all transportation modes. Through its diverse sessions and workshops, the meeting addresses critical topics tailored to the interests and needs of policymakers, administrators, practitioners, researchers, and representatives from government, industry, and academic institutions. By fostering collaboration and knowledge-sharing, the TRB Annual Meeting continues to serve as a cornerstone event for advancing innovation and excellence across the transportation sector.

Event Overview
Cosmointel successfully participated in the 104th Transportation Research Board (TRB) Annual Meeting held in Washington, D.C., from January 5 to 9, 2025. This prestigious event attracted global transportation professionals, featuring over 170 committees, 350 sessions, 100 workshops, and 320 exhibitors, fostering innovation and collaboration in the transportation sector.
